Logging in then logging out?
« on: May 20, 2007, 05:55:33 AM »
I am having problems with my laptop (HP Pavilion zv600) which includes Windows XP Home Edition SP2.

After "logging in" in my user account, it suddenly logs off. It always happen everytime I could access my account in my laptop.

Before, I don't have any problems logging in my account.

By the way, I do only have one (1) user account and the Guest account is not seen in the start-up.

What shall I do?
